Quoting group PICT MANY (grouppict at gmail.com):
> Trying to upgrade the lxc version from 0.7.5 to 0.8.0. Executed following
> command :
> 
> apt-get install lxc
> 
> But it didnt work the package is still 0.7.5.
> 
> apt-get install lxc=0.8.0
> 
> Gives error saying
> 
> E: Version '0.8.0' for 'lxc' was not found
> 
> How to upgrade it to next version (0.8.0 the specific)? Please help! Thanks!

Depends on what distro and release you are using.  If you are using
ubuntu, you can either add ubuntu-backports to your archives for
somewhat newer lxc, or add ppa:ubuntu-lxc/daily for truly bleeding edge.
